package proxy
import (
"io"
"net"
"net/http"
"net/http/httputil"
"net/url"
"strings"
"time"
)
type Director struct {
Platform *url.URL
AI *url.URL
Timeout time.Duration
}
func New(platformURL, aiURL string, timeoutSec int) (*Director, error) {
p, err := url.Parse(platformURL)
if err != nil {
return nil, err
}
a, err := url.Parse(aiURL)
if err != nil {
return nil, err
}
if timeoutSec <= 0 {
timeoutSec = 60
}
return &Director{Platform: p, AI: a, Timeout: time.Duration(timeoutSec) * time.Second}, nil
}
func (d *Director) Handler() http.HandlerFunc {
transport := &http.Transport{
Proxy: http.ProxyFromEnvironment,
DialContext: (&net.Dialer{
Timeout: 10 * time.Second,
KeepAlive: 30 * time.Second,
}).DialContext,
MaxIdleConns: 100,
IdleConnTimeout: 90 * time.Second,
TLSHandshakeTimeout: 10 * time.Second,
ExpectContinueTimeout: 1 * time.Second,
}
return func(w http.ResponseWriter, r *http.Request) {
target, path := d.route(r.URL.Path)
proxy := httputil.NewSingleHostReverseProxy(target)
proxy.Transport = transport
proxy.FlushInterval = 100 * time.Millisecond
proxy.ErrorHandler = func(rw http.ResponseWriter, req *http.Request, err error) {
rw.Header().Set("Content-Type", "application/json")
rw.WriteHeader(http.StatusBadGateway)
_, _ = rw.Write([]byte(`{"code":502,"message":"upstream unavailable: ` + escape(err.Error()) + `"}`))
}
proxy.ModifyResponse = func(resp *http.Response) error {
// 网关已统一加 CORS去掉上游重复头避免浏览器报 Failed to fetch
for _, h := range []string{
"Access-Control-Allow-Origin",
"Access-Control-Allow-Credentials",
"Access-Control-Allow-Headers",
"Access-Control-Allow-Methods",
"Access-Control-Expose-Headers",
"Access-Control-Max-Age",
} {
resp.Header.Del(h)
}
resp.Header.Set("X-Gateway", "aijianzhan-gateway")
return nil
}
// 重写路径
r.URL.Path = path
r.Host = target.Host
r.Header.Set("X-Forwarded-Host", r.Header.Get("Host"))
r.Header.Set("X-Forwarded-Proto", "http")
if r.Header.Get("X-Request-Id") == "" {
r.Header.Set("X-Request-Id", newRequestID())
}
// 超时上下文
ctx := r.Context()
proxy.ServeHTTP(w, r.WithContext(ctx))
}
}
func (d *Director) route(path string) (*url.URL, string) {
// AI/ai/* → 上游去掉 /ai 前缀
if strings.HasPrefix(path, "/ai/") || path == "/ai" {
next := strings.TrimPrefix(path, "/ai")
if next == "" {
next = "/"
}
return d.AI, next
}
// 生成蓝图:统一 /api/v1/apps/generate兼容旧冒号路径避免重复实现
if path == "/api/v1/apps/generate" || strings.HasPrefix(path, "/api/v1/apps/generate?") {
return d.AI, path
}
if strings.HasPrefix(path, "/api/v1/apps:generate") || strings.Contains(path, "/apps%3Agenerate") {
return d.AI, "/api/v1/apps/generate"
}
// 其余 /api 走中台
return d.Platform, path
}
func escape(s string) string {
s = strings.ReplaceAll(s, `\`, `\\`)
s = strings.ReplaceAll(s, `"`, `\"`)
if len(s) > 200 {
s = s[:200]
}
return s
}
func newRequestID() string {
return strings.ReplaceAll(time.Now().UTC().Format("20060102T150405.000000000"), ".", "")
}
